資源簡介 (共14張PPT)枚舉算法信息科技-五下小睿給行李箱設(shè)置了一個三位數(shù)的密碼,但他忘記了最后一位數(shù)字,導(dǎo)致行李箱無法打開。你能幫小睿找回密碼嗎 行李箱密碼由三位數(shù)字組成,每一位的數(shù)字都由0~9組成。因此,對于個位數(shù),我們只要將這十個數(shù)字逐一嘗試,就可以找到正確的數(shù)字。像找尋行李箱密碼,逐一列舉所有可能的結(jié)果,再根據(jù)條件判斷得出正確答案的算法,我們稱之為枚舉算法或窮舉算法。枚舉算法是將問題所有可能的答案一一列舉出來,然后從中找出符合題目要求的答案。如果讓你數(shù)出罐子里不同顏色的糖果數(shù)量,你會怎么做 數(shù)糖果的過程是一個枚舉的過程,這種方法常被用來解決那些需要通過列舉所有可能性來尋找答案的問題。根據(jù)枚舉的過程,可以繪制出枚舉算法流程圖。假設(shè)行李箱密碼是 396,但是忘記了個位數(shù),利用枚舉算法找出密碼。1、找到正確密碼的判斷條件是什么 2、完善右邊程序枚舉算法三要素在尋找行李箱密碼的算法中,我們需不斷嘗試各種可能的密碼組合并進行比對。這些不同的密碼組合稱為枚舉對象,0~9的數(shù)字范圍稱為枚舉范圍,判斷某個組合是否是正確密碼的條件稱為判定條件。因此,枚舉對象、枚舉范圍和判定條件稱為枚舉三要素。枚舉對象是可能滿足問題條件的所有元素或組合的集合,這也是枚舉的基礎(chǔ)。枚舉范圍是枚舉算法中定義的一組值,這些值代表了所有可能的枚舉對象。判定條件是枚舉算法中用于判斷枚舉對象是否符合特定要求的標準或規(guī)則。在枚舉過程中,每個枚舉對象都會根據(jù)這些條件進行檢查,從而篩選出符合要求的答案。枚舉算法三要素在找尋行李箱密碼的算法中,枚舉對象是?枚舉范圍是?判定條件是?小試身手找出1000以內(nèi)所有能被3和5同時整除的三位數(shù)。1、枚舉對象、枚舉范圍和判定條件分別是什么 小試身手找出1000以內(nèi)所有能被3和5同時整除的三位數(shù)。2、假設(shè)用變量m 代表這個三位數(shù),將右圖 補充完整。小試身手找出1000以內(nèi)所有能被3和5同時整除的三位數(shù)。3、根據(jù)算法流程圖,在圖形化編程軟件中編寫程序并調(diào)試運行。挑戰(zhàn)自我1、小睿有1元、5角和1角的硬幣各若干枚,他要用這些硬幣湊出3元錢,他有多少種不同的湊法 ()A. 19 種B.18種C. 17 種D.16 種挑戰(zhàn)自我2、枚舉算法在數(shù)學題中應(yīng)用廣泛,你遇到過哪些問題可以采用枚舉算法來解決 THANK YOU 展開更多...... 收起↑ 資源預(yù)覽 縮略圖、資源來源于二一教育資源庫